Can a 4 wheel drive car be shifted to low range?

Shifting into low-range four-wheel drive is a little more involved than shifting into high-range four-wheel drive. Drivers will need to shift the transmission into neutral to disconnect torque to allow the transfer case to shift gears.

What’s the difference between a 2003 GMC Sierra?

GMC Sierra is redesigned for 2003. It comes with a bolder, raked front end. Its interior is new as well, redesigned for improved function and appearance. The brakes have been upgraded, and the engines run cleaner. New options include a Bose sound system.

What is the trim level of a 2003 Sierra?

The basic trim level for 2003 is the W/T work truck, which comes with vinyl seats and air conditioning but not carpeting. The Standard Sierra upgrades to cloth seats and carpeting. SLE adds niceties such as a CD player, cruise control, and a leather-wrapped steering wheel.

Which is the most trouble free GMC Sierra?

By far, the most trouble-free model has been the 1997 GMC Sierra 1500, which has received very few complaints. However, the 2014 model has had by far the most reports of issues, primarily having to do with sub-par headlights and poor visibility. GMC Sierra 1500 accessories for that model year have also had a number of issues.

Historically, General Motors has promoted the Silverado to agriculture, while the Sierra is aimed more toward the construction industry. Mechanically however, GMC Sierra 1500 accessories and mechanical parts are interchangeable with those of the Chevy Silverado.

When did the GMC Sierra crew cab come out?

The 1999 GMC Sierra was launched as a regular cab and extended cab model with rear access doors. A crew cab version of the Sierra was not added until the 2005 model year.

When did the GMC Sierra 1500 Hybrid come out?

A new hybrid version of the GMC Sierra was introduced for 2009 combining two electric motors with a 6-liter V-8 gasoline engine. What was the steering system on the GMC Sierra 1500?

A four-wheel steering system called Quadrasteer was briefly available on the GMC Sierra 1500 (standard on the 2002 Sierra Denali). Due to the high-price of the technology and lack of consumer interest, Quadasteer was discontinued after a few years.

What is the maximum weight of a GMC Sierra 1500?

Maximum gross vehicle weight rating: 7,000 pounds (4×4 crew cab, extended cab) Maximum payload capacity: 1,924 pounds (4×2 crew cab short box) Maximum towing capacity: 10,700 pounds (4×2 extended cab with enhanced trailer package, 6.2-liter V-8 and 3.73 rear axle) Fuel tank capacity: 26 gallons (SWB), 34 gallons (LWB)

What kind of interior does GMC Sierra 1500 have?

The 2009 GMC Sierra 1500 benefits from GM’s extensive reworking of both full-size pickups and full-size SUVs, and among the benefits are two distinct interiors. The work truck and SLE trim levels feature the “pure pickup” interior that features larger controls – designed to accommodate gloved hands – and a double glovebox.

How does the knock sensor on a Chevy truck work?

The knock sensor sends a signal to the PCM (the truck engine’s computer) to tell the computer about ignition timing. The knock sensor uses two flat-response two-wire sensors. They produce voltage based on engine vibration and noise level.

How does a GMC Sierra 1500 fuel pump work?

The older model has steel lines coming off of the top of the pump to the frame rail and then connects to the frame steel lines with short hoses, you’ll need line wrenches and the ability to curse. The newer style has plastic tubes from the plastic pump casing and uses those quick connect fuel fittings and you’ll need the disconnect tool.
